At over two hours long, the film also runs for too long, especially given the plot has limited resolution or payoff in a way that would be directly satisfying for the audience. For a film that supposedly cost $160 million to make, the visual effects look very cheesy and artificial as well. The film's attempts at both humor and scares fall flat, as the jokes are formulaic and corny while the attempts at more frightening moments fail to elicit any tension or suspense, and are quite repetitive and CGI-heavy. ![]() While the film tries to utilize the setting of New Orleans in some decently authentic ways, the rest of the plot and character development is so generic that they fail to make viewers more engaged in the setting. The film follows a single mother and her son who move into the Haunted Mansion, which is in New Orleans. ![]() It's not simply that "Haunted Mansion" might be too scary for younger kids and too juvenile for older kids, as that would not be a problem if the movie was good or interesting-it's just that this film overall isn't very good or interesting, period. Yet the film fell short of my expectations, simply because it is so generic and derivative that it fails to offer the viewer anything new. It also has a talented cast including LaKeith Stanfield, Owen Wilson, and Danny DeVito. I wasn't expecting Disney's "Haunted Mansion" film to be a masterpiece by any stretch of the imagination, but I was hoping it would be good entertainment, as the trailers seemed to make it look a bit more fun and authentic than some of Disney's other ride adaptations. ![]()
